Individual effect of recrystallisation nucleation sites on texture weakening in a magnesium alloy: Part 2- shear bands
The entire recrystallisation process of a cold-rolled WE43 Mg alloy containing a high density of shear bands was tracked using a quasi-in-situ electron backscatter diffraction method. The results showed the resultant recrystallised texture arose principally from recrystallisation within shear bands rather than from deformation twins, which made a negligible contribution to the final texture.
